How to Turn On Android Theft Protection, Identity Check and Remote Lock

To enable Android theft protection, open Settings > Google > All services > Theft protection. Turn on every supported automatic lock, complete Identity Check, activate Remote Lock with your verified phone number, and confirm that the phone appears in Find Hub.
Complete and verify this setup before the phone is lost or stolen. The controls protect different stages of an incident: Identity Check restricts sensitive changes, automatic locks react to suspicious conditions, Remote Lock provides a quick web-based response, and Find Hub handles locating, marking lost and erasing the device.
Run a pre-theft audit
Do not assume every protection was enabled during initial setup. Google notes that availability can vary by device and market, while its current theft-protection requirements exclude Android Go devices, tablets and wearables from this group of features and require a screen lock.
- Confirm that the phone has a PIN, password or pattern.
- Enroll a supported fingerprint or face-unlock method.
- Open Theft protection and inspect every available control individually.
- Verify the number configured for Remote Lock.
- Confirm that Find Hub is enabled and lists the correct phone.
- Store a Google Account backup sign-in method somewhere other than the phone.
A missing option is not necessarily a configuration error. The official Android compatibility guidance says a device does not support Identity Check if that option is absent and does not support Theft Detection Lock if its control is greyed out. Manufacturer software can also move or rename the menus.
Set the screen lock and biometrics first
A screen credential is the foundation for the theft-protection controls. Choose a PIN or password that cannot be inferred from your birthday, telephone number or information visible on the lock screen, and make sure you can recall it without consulting the phone.
Next, enroll a supported fingerprint or face-unlock method in the device’s security settings. Identity Check requires biometric authentication for protected actions outside trusted places, and the official Android compatibility note limits the feature to devices that support class 3 biometrics.
Verify both methods by locking the phone, unlocking once with biometrics and once with the PIN or password. If another person knows the existing credential, change it before continuing: Identity Check is most useful when an unauthorized person might possess both the phone and knowledge of its screen code.
Turn on Identity Check on Pixel and Samsung phones

On a Pixel or another device that exposes Google’s standard menu, open Settings > Google > All services > Theft protection > Identity Check. Google’s Identity Check instructions require you to sign in to a Google Account, add a screen lock and biometrics, configure trusted places and then tap Done.
On compatible Samsung Galaxy software, use Settings > Security and privacy > Lost device protection > Theft protection > Identity check. Samsung’s Galaxy setup guide documents that path and warns that features and settings vary by phone model and software version.
Some other brands place the page under Settings > Security and privacy > Device unlock > Theft protection, a route documented in Tom’s Guide’s cross-brand walkthrough. If neither route matches, search Settings for “Theft protection” or “Identity Check”; searching cannot expose a feature that the device does not support.
Choose trusted places narrowly. Outside them, Identity Check strictly requires biometrics instead of allowing a PIN, pattern or password when an app invokes the supported identity-verification prompt. Protected actions include changing the screen lock or biometrics, running a factory reset, turning off Find Hub or theft protection, accessing saved Google Password Manager credentials, and adding or removing a Google Account.
A stable home may be a reasonable trusted place if access is controlled. A workplace shared with the public, a transport hub or another broad area where the phone is frequently exposed is a weaker choice because Identity Check relaxes its location-based biometric requirement there.
Enable each automatic lock separately
Return to the main Theft protection page and inspect every control. The similarly named protections react to different conditions:
- Theft Detection Lock uses motion sensors together with Wi-Fi and Bluetooth context to detect movement associated with a phone being taken and carried away. It may not trigger during stable Wi-Fi or Bluetooth connections or after repeated locks in a short period.
- Offline Device Lock locks an unlocked phone after it has been used without an internet connection for a short period. Under Google’s Offline Device Lock rules, the screen can be locked this way twice within a 24-hour period.
- Failed Authentication Lock locks the device after authentication attempts fail repeatedly.
These trigger conditions and limits are documented separately in Google’s feature-by-feature guidance. Some protections may already be enabled by default, so the useful check is their final state rather than whether you remember activating them.
Do not attempt to test Theft Detection Lock by staging a street snatch or running with an unlocked phone. Confirm that the control remains enabled after you leave and reopen Settings; the feature is a risk-reduction layer, not a guarantee that every theft-like movement will be detected.
Activate and rehearse Remote Lock
Open Settings > Google > All services > Theft protection > Remote Lock, enable the control and verify the phone number if prompted. Remote Lock requires a screen lock, an active SIM, a verified number, Find Hub, and an internet connection; an offline phone processes a pending request after reconnecting.
You may also add the optional security question shown in Remote Lock settings. Record the answer securely and allow time for a newly configured question to update on the remote-lock website, because an incorrect answer causes the request to fail.
For a controlled rehearsal, keep the phone beside you and visit android.com/lock from another device. Enter the phone number, complete the CAPTCHA and any configured security question, request the lock, then unlock the phone locally with its normal screen credential. Under Google’s Remote Lock rules, a device can be locked remotely twice within a 24-hour period, so do not repeat the test unnecessarily.
Remote Lock is a fast fallback, not a replacement for Find Hub. It does not require you to sign in to the missing phone’s Google Account from the borrowed device, while Find Hub provides the broader location, lost-mode and erasure tools.
Verify Find Hub without erasing the phone
Open Find Hub in a browser or on another Android device, sign in to the Google Account associated with the phone and select it. Confirm that the correct handset appears, then use Play sound while it is nearby. This tests account access and delivery of a harmless remote action.
According to Google’s Find Hub requirements, remote securing or erasure depends on the phone having power, a mobile-data or Wi-Fi connection, Google Account sign-in, Find Hub enabled and visibility in Google Play. A current position is therefore not guaranteed; Find Hub may instead show an available recent location.
If your Google Account requires an additional sign-in factor, save backup codes or another usable factor outside the phone. Being able to see the Find Hub page while already signed in on a laptop does not prove that you can recover the account from an unfamiliar device.
Do not press Factory reset as a test. Merely confirming that the control exists is sufficient because executing it permanently deletes phone data and ends location availability in Find Hub.
Match each control to its job
The screen credential blocks ordinary local access. Theft Detection Lock and Offline Device Lock try to close an already-unlocked screen under specific conditions, while Failed Authentication Lock reacts to repeated failures. Identity Check adds biometric enforcement around sensitive actions outside trusted places.
Remote Lock lets you close the screen quickly from a web browser using the configured phone-number flow. Find Hub then supports account-authenticated location and recovery actions. Google’s Android protection overview separates the suite into preventive safeguards, automatic reactions and actions taken after a phone disappears.
No layer physically prevents theft, guarantees that a detector will trigger or promises recovery. Enabling the controls together reduces different risks without making them interchangeable.
Use a tracking-preserving order after theft

If the phone is stolen, protect access quickly but avoid making erasure your first reflex when safe recovery and location tracking remain realistic.
- Use Remote Lock from android.com/lock if you cannot enter Find Hub immediately.
- Sign in to Find Hub, inspect the available location and choose Mark as lost to lock the phone and add safe return details.
- Record the handset’s identifying information and ask the mobile carrier to suspend service or protect the number against SIM misuse.
- If the thief may have observed the screen code or accessed an unlocked phone, secure the primary email account, Google Account, password manager, financial services and carrier account.
- Choose remote factory reset only when recovery is no longer credible or the data risk outweighs the value of retaining location access.
Do not travel to an unfamiliar location to confront a suspected thief; give relevant location and device information to local authorities where appropriate. Marking the phone as lost preserves the possibility of locating it, whereas Google’s Find Hub guidance warns that location becomes unavailable after erasure and that removable SD cards may not be deleted.
Finish the preparation now by storing the Google Account needed for Find Hub, a backup sign-in method and the carrier’s support route away from the handset. Repeat the audit after a factory reset, phone-number change, major software upgrade or migration to another phone.
